I’ve recently been consuming insufficient nutrients, and my doctor suggested eating foods rich in minerals. What foods are rich in minerals?
1. Calcium-rich foods: legumes, dairy products, and bones.
2. Phosphorus-rich foods: whole grains, soybeans, broad beans, peanuts, meat, eggs, fish, shrimp, dairy products, and liver.
3. Iron-rich foods: liver is the richest dietary source of iron.
4. Zinc-rich foods: kelp, oysters, soybeans, eggplants, and lentils.
5. Iodine-rich foods: kelp and nori (dried laver).
6. Selenium-rich foods: seafood, liver, kidneys, meat, and rice.
